About Carrington

Community overview based on MLS listing data for Carrington, Lexington

Carrington is a new Lexington subdivision defined by recent construction, modern floor plans, and easy access to the neighborhood pool area. Homes here were built between 2022 and 2025, and current asking prices span roughly $305,000 to $409,000, with community-level averages around $357,000.

Community Highlights

Most homes in Carrington fall in the four- to five-bedroom range, with living areas from about 1,956 to 3,040 square feet. The dominant layout is a two-story plan with open main living spaces, large kitchen islands, walk-in pantries, and upstairs loft or bonus areas. Main-level flex rooms appear repeatedly, sometimes as dedicated offices and sometimes as first-floor guest bedrooms with an adjacent full bath.

Finishes lean firmly toward the newer-construction look. Homes here regularly feature luxury vinyl plank flooring, white Shaker cabinetry, granite or quartz counters, farmhouse or upgraded sinks, gas fireplaces, coffered dining ceilings, tankless water heaters, sprinkler systems, and home automation features. Covered porches, sunrooms, fenced yards, and multiple walk-in closets show up often enough to feel like part of the community pattern rather than one-off upgrades.

Amenities & Lifestyle

The community pool, playground, and poolside cabana form the clearest shared amenity cluster in Carrington. Some homes sit just steps from that recreation area, giving the neighborhood an everyday focal point beyond the individual houses. Lot sizes are compact and notably consistent, generally running from about 5,662 to 6,098 square feet, which gives the neighborhood a more uniform streetscape than a large-lot subdivision. A small number of homes back to wooded edges, but the prevailing character is a polished, recently built single-family community with landscaped yards and efficient use of space.

Location & Schools

Carrington sits off the Springhill Road and Highway 378 corridor, placing downtown Lexington, everyday shopping and dining, and Lake Murray within an easy drive. Rocky Creek Elementary, Beechwood Middle School, and Lexington High School serve the neighborhood, and the Lexington One school zone is a regular part of the neighborhood story.
